This album has always taken it under the chin with music critics & fans alike. I always liked it as an experimental work & the fact that the band was so distracted with other issues in '67 that they managed to produce anything by years end. The North African influence is there & cool to hear. I still have my original 3-D cover in excellent condition. While the cover may be Pepperesque. The music is unique & different from anything produced that year. A solid warmup for Beggar's Banquet!
